Advance Medical Directives
Advance Medical Directives (AMD) (often know as
Living Wills)
are a badly underused and most important facility, as
most people concentrate on the least important aspect of them.
They can accomplish two things:
 | Putting someone you appoint in charge of your
medical decision making if you are unconscious or otherwise rendered
incapable. Without the appointment of a Medical Proxy,
no one has any rights - not your husband, wife, partner or
children. They may be consulted, but their opinions have no
real weight. The British Medical Association has made it a
disciplinary offence to disregard a properly appointed Medical
Proxy. So everyone over 18 should appoint one, and single
people and unmarried couples should consider doing so vital. |
 | Making your views on treatments known in advance -
some people have very strong views, others do not, and the Advance
Medical Directive / Living Will can be tailored to give Medical
Proxies wide latitude or none. |
